You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by qi...@apache.org on 2022/01/20 04:17:03 UTC

[iotdb] branch master updated (93ee9e0 -> 6acd4ff)

This is an automated email from the ASF dual-hosted git repository.

qiaojialin p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/iotdb.git.


    from 93ee9e0  disable e2e and cluster workflow (#4917)
     add 6acd4ff  [IOTDB-2326] Clean compaction code (#4904)

No new revisions were added by this update.

Summary of changes:
 docs/UserGuide/Reference/Config-Manual.md          | 320 +++++++++++----------
 docs/zh/UserGuide/Reference/Config-Manual.md       | 150 ++++------
 .../db/integration/IoTDBNewTsFileCompactionIT.java |   7 -
 .../iotdb/db/integration/IoTDBSeriesReaderIT.java  |   7 -
 .../integration/IoTDBSizeTieredCompactionIT.java   |  71 +++--
 .../resources/conf/iotdb-engine.properties         |  41 +--
 .../java/org/apache/iotdb/db/conf/IoTDBConfig.java |  92 ++----
 .../org/apache/iotdb/db/conf/IoTDBDescriptor.java  |  39 +--
 .../compaction/CompactionTaskComparator.java       |  12 +-
 .../engine/compaction/CompactionTaskManager.java   |   3 +-
 .../db/engine/compaction/CompactionUtils.java      |  15 +-
 .../compaction/cross/CrossCompactionStrategy.java  |  12 +-
 .../RewriteCrossSpaceCompactionSelector.java       |   2 +-
 .../selector/MaxSeriesMergeFileSelector.java       | 115 --------
 ...tor.java => RewriteCompactionFileSelector.java} |   9 +-
 .../task/RewriteCrossSpaceCompactionTask.java      |  28 +-
 .../inner/sizetiered/SizeTieredCompactionTask.java |  23 +-
 .../inner/utils/InnerSpaceCompactionUtils.java     |  43 +--
 .../utils/SingleSeriesCompactionExecutor.java      |  40 +--
 .../storagegroup/VirtualStorageGroupProcessor.java |   4 +-
 .../virtualSg/StorageGroupManager.java             |   2 +-
 .../engine/compaction/AbstractCompactionTest.java  |   2 +
 .../engine/compaction/CompactionSchedulerTest.java |   3 +
 .../db/engine/compaction/CompactionUtilsTest.java  | 125 ++++----
 .../cross/CrossSpaceCompactionExceptionTest.java   |  12 +-
 .../compaction/cross/CrossSpaceCompactionTest.java |  10 +-
 .../cross/MaxSeriesMergeFileSelectorTest.java      | 108 -------
 .../db/engine/compaction/cross/MergeTest.java      |  11 +-
 .../engine/compaction/cross/MergeUpgradeTest.java  |   8 +-
 ...java => RewriteCompactionFileSelectorTest.java} |  23 +-
 .../RewriteCrossSpaceCompactionRecoverTest.java    |  10 +-
 .../inner/AbstractInnerSpaceCompactionTest.java    |  11 +-
 .../compaction/inner/InnerCompactionTest.java      |   9 +-
 .../compaction/inner/InnerSeqCompactionTest.java   |  27 +-
 .../inner/InnerSpaceCompactionExceptionTest.java   |  14 +-
 .../InnerSpaceCompactionUtilsAlignedTest.java      |  16 +-
 .../InnerSpaceCompactionUtilsNoAlignedTest.java    |  18 +-
 .../inner/InnerSpaceCompactionUtilsOldTest.java    |   4 +-
 .../compaction/inner/InnerUnseqCompactionTest.java |   8 +-
 .../SizeTieredCompactionHandleExceptionTest.java   |   2 +
 .../SizeTieredCompactionRecoverTest.java           |  18 +-
 .../inner/sizetiered/SizeTieredCompactionTest.java |  11 +-
 .../recover/SizeTieredCompactionRecoverTest.java   |  18 +-
 .../compaction/utils/CompactionConfigRestorer.java |  69 +++++
 .../storagegroup/StorageGroupProcessorTest.java    |   2 +-
 45 files changed, 672 insertions(+), 902 deletions(-)
 delete mode 100644 server/src/main/java/org/apache/iotdb/db/engine/compaction/cross/rewrite/selector/MaxSeriesMergeFileSelector.java
 rename server/src/main/java/org/apache/iotdb/db/engine/compaction/cross/rewrite/selector/{MaxFileMergeFileSelector.java => RewriteCompactionFileSelector.java} (97%)
 delete mode 100644 server/src/test/java/org/apache/iotdb/db/engine/compaction/cross/MaxSeriesMergeFileSelectorTest.java
 rename server/src/test/java/org/apache/iotdb/db/engine/compaction/cross/{MaxFileMergeFileSelectorTest.java => RewriteCompactionFileSelectorTest.java} (93%)
 create mode 100644 server/src/test/java/org/apache/iotdb/db/engine/compaction/utils/CompactionConfigRestorer.java